Description

** Guide Price £260,000 - £270,000 ** Situated in the highly sought after Goldstone Valley area of Hove, this spacious two bedroom purpose built apartment offers the rare benefit of its own street level entrance, eliminating the need for stairs, and is sold with a share of freehold. An excellent opportunity for both first time buyers and investors alike, the property is currently tenanted and available with tenants in situ, achieving £1,500 pcm (approx. 6.92% gross yield).

The accommodation is well presented and generously proportioned throughout, comprising a bright and airy living room, a separate fitted kitchen/dining room, two good-sized double bedrooms, and a family bathroom.

Ideally positioned, the property provides easy access to Old Shoreham Road, while the vibrant amenities of Portland Road and Poets’ Corner, offering an array of shops, cafes, bars, and restaurants, are all within close proximity.

Hove Park is nearby, offering a wide range of leisure facilities including tennis courts, a children’s playground, landscaped gardens, café, picnic areas, and a charming miniature railway. A Waitrose superstore and the local amenities along Hangleton Road are also conveniently located.

Excellent transport links include regular bus services providing access to Brighton & Hove city centre, the seafront, and surrounding areas. Aldrington and Hove mainline railway stations offer direct routes to London and Gatwick, while the A27 is easily accessible for road commuters.

Nevill Road falls outside of a controlled parking zone, offering greater flexibility for residents and visitors.

A particular highlight of this property is the beautifully maintained communal gardens, which enjoy pleasant views across Goldstone Valley. These provide a peaceful and attractive outdoor space, ideal for relaxing, socialising, or enjoying the surroundings.
